I recently lost the ability to launch WinXP 2003 Excel successfully by
clicking on a file. Actually, Excel opens but no file appears - grey screen. When I click an Excel file, Excel launches but does not load the file - I have to then open the file via Excel's open commands (File=Open). I can't seem to trace the problem back to any event. Thanks for any insight. CW |
